On Thu, 20 Nov 1997, Max Khon wrote:

> Hi, there!
> 
> i've got several IBM PC 350 P100 workstations (P100, 82437FX (Triton), S3
> Trio 64V+ onboard, 16(32)M, PS/2 mouse, PS/2 kbd, AMD PCNet/PCI based
> network card)
> 
> 3.0-CURRENT:
>   everything works fine (raw ftp ~900-950K/s)
> 
> 2.2.5-STABLE:
>   - cannot shutdown properly (do not sync disks) - KBD_BROKEN_RESET does
> not help
>   - raw ftp throughput is about 20-30K/s. lnc driver works with AMD
> PCNet/PCI cards in 16-bit mode. i wrote device driver which works with AMD
> PCNet/PCI in 32-bit mode - does not help. this is not BOUNCE_BUFFERS
> problem as someone noticed earlier, because
> 1) i tried this on workstations with 16M
> 2) on workstations with 32M i tried both lnc with 'option BOUNCE_BUFFERS'
> in kernel config and my own driver which does not need BOUNCE_BUFFERS
> 
> any comments?
>
Concerning lnc:
 
While in the age of 2.1-... i've got the PC-Net/PCI driver working (breed
from linux of my own). The problem of working/notworking was purely
in alignment (AMD's are a bit crazy on that, not bounce buffers. If you
want to have a look, drop me a note, i'll give it to you.
Also William D. Ward <euswdwj@exu.ericsson.se> is investigating the
problems with AMD drivers right now.
